BHU's LLD (Doctor of Laws) is a 3-year doctoral program emphasizing original legal research, interdisciplinary studies, and contributions to jurisprudence, awarded to scholars with significant post-LLM expertise. Delivered offline on the Varanasi campus, it requires a thesis submission and viva voce, with admissions based on BHU-RET scores for 2026 intake.
The LLD at Banaras Hindu University is a prestigious research-oriented doctorate in law, spanning 3 years, designed for legal experts to produce high-impact theses on topics like constitutional law, international law, or human rights. Unlike a PhD, it focuses on honorary recognition for established scholars, with coursework in research methodology and seminars. As per the official BHU website, the program integrates Varanasi's cultural heritage into legal studies, fostering ethical jurisprudence.

Eligibility for BHU LLD 2026 requires an LLM degree with at least 55% marks (50% for SC/ST) from a UGC-recognized university, plus 5 years of post-LLM teaching or professional experience. Candidates must submit a 1,000-word research synopsis during application. Age limit is not specified, but full-time scholars need UGC-NET/JRF qualification for stipends.

The BHU LLD spans 3 years minimum, extendable to 5 years, with semesters focused on research milestones: proposal defense in year 1, data collection in year 2, and thesis submission in year 3. Includes 6 credits of coursework in advanced legal theory.
Core components include Research Methodology, Jurisprudential Theories, and Elective Seminars on Contemporary Legal Issues. Thesis (80,000 words) forms 70% evaluation, with publications in UGC-CARE journals mandatory for two papers.

BHU-RET for LLD comprises 100 MCQs (2 hours) on legal aptitude, research methods, and jurisprudence, with 1 mark each and no negative marking. Qualifying score: 50/100 for General.
